Ordinals
beta
Sat 665530555051617
decimal
133106.555051617
degree
0°133106′50″555051617‴
percentile
31.691931227795283%
name
jdedmpfdhqu
cycle
0
epoch
0
period
66
block
133106
offset
555051617
timestamp
2011-06-24 19:53:54 UTC
rarity
common
prev
next